Binomial Nomenclature is the system of naming species of living things by giving each a name composed of two parts- the generic name (also known as the genus) and the specific epithet (i.e- species)
E,g-
Scientific name of Mango is Mangifera indica
Here, Mangifera is the generic name (genus) and indica is the specific epithet (species)
